I applied through university.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at Samsung Electronics (Nanjing, Jiangsu) in Jul 2023
Interview
It starts with a phone screen discussing fundamentals like Kotlin, Java, and core Android components. If successful, you'll proceed to a technical interview, which usually includes live coding on a platform like CoderPad or a pair programming exercise. Here, you might be asked to build a simple feature or debug existing code, testing your knowledge of architecture patterns like MVVM, Jetpack libraries, and threading. The final rounds often involve a system design question and behavioral interviews to assess your problem-solving approach and team fit.
